1 Selection based on total population for midyear 2007.
2 First-level enrollment consists of elementary school, typically corresponding to grades 1–6 in the United States.
3 Second-level enrollment includes general education, teacher training (at the second level), and technical and vocational education. This level generally corresponds to secondary education in the United States, grades 7–12.
4 Third-level enrollment includes college and university enrollment, and technical and vocational education beyond the secondary school level.
5 Data represent the total enrollment of all ages in the school level divided by the population of the specific age groups that correspond to the school level. Adjustments have been made for the varying lengths of first and second level programs. Ratios may exceed 100 because some countries have many students from outside the normal age range.
6 Enrollment totals and ratios exclude Democratic People's Republic of Korea. Data do not include adult education or special education provided outside regular schools.
